Output 51511e263e0405275cc639bc76d90d4facede4bae74f89fc2918ff0578588149:78

value
2874859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3395c69ee98e175c790e45d9be16d65ef5ecd1eb OP_EQUAL
address
36PmowGVy7VrX15Xt3j1bvfbMdp66a76Uk
transaction
51511e263e0405275cc639bc76d90d4facede4bae74f89fc2918ff0578588149
confirmations
239933
spent
true